1. What eyebrow shape for what face shape?
Choosing the right eyebrow shape can help balance your face by harmonizing its features. Each face shape requires a specific approach to highlight its natural proportions.
- Square face : This face shape is characterized by a pronounced jawline and angular lines. To soften these angles, it's recommended to opt for slightly arched eyebrows with a softer tip. Avoid eyebrows that are too straight, as they can further harden your features. A subtle curve adds a touch of softness and feminizes the look.
-
Round face : Round faces have soft, undefined contours. To create the illusion of length and add structure to your features, it's best to opt for arched, slightly angular eyebrows. A well-defined arch creates a vertical appearance and avoids accentuating the circular effect of the face. It's best to avoid overly rounded eyebrows, which can accentuate the natural roundness.
-
Rectangular face : This face is longer than it is wide, with a jawline and forehead that are often well-defined. To balance the length of the face, straighter, thicker eyebrows are ideal. They create the illusion of width and soften the elongated appearance of the face. Too much curvature could further accentuate the verticality of the face.
-
Oval face : This is the most balanced face shape, allowing for almost any eyebrow shape. A slightly arched eyebrow, neither too thin nor too thick, highlights the features without unbalancing the face. The goal is to maintain harmonious symmetry while avoiding extremes.
- Heart-shaped face : This face shape features a wider forehead and a thinner, more delicate chin. To harmonize these proportions, slightly rounded eyebrows are ideal, as they soften the upper part of the face and create a natural balance with the thinness of the chin. Too much curvature or very straight eyebrows could draw even more attention to the forehead.
-
Diamond Face : Characterized by high cheekbones and a narrower forehead, this face shape benefits from slightly curved, natural-looking eyebrows. This shape softens the contours of the face while highlighting bone structure. An eyebrow that is too angular would accentuate harsh lines, while one that is too rounded could disrupt the natural balance of features.
2. The current trend: straight eyebrows
The trend for straight brows has emerged with the "clean girl" trend. This sophisticated and understated look emphasizes a structured brow without a pronounced arch, creating a minimalist and refined look.
However, while this trend is very aesthetic, it doesn't suit all face shapes. On a round face, for example, eyebrows that are too straight risk accentuating the "ball" effect and flattening the features. Furthermore, this trend has led to some abuse on social media, particularly on TikTok, where some people go so far as to shave off half of their eyebrows to redraw them with a pencil. This risky practice can lead to long-term hair loss.
If you do want to follow the trend, even if your face shape doesn't match straight eyebrows, it's recommended to lightly pluck your eyebrows, but without distorting your base or thinning them too much, at the risk of losing too much of your natural hair.
3. The browlift: the trend for structured eyebrows
A browlift is a revolutionary technique that restructures and disciplines eyebrows by positioning them upwards. This process creates an immediate lifting effect, widens the eyes, and brings a touch of freshness to the face. By enhancing natural hairs, it gives a fuller, more defined appearance, while maintaining a harmonious and sophisticated finish.
This treatment is ideal for those who want a natural and structured effect, without resorting to permanent makeup. It is particularly recommended for people with sparse, unruly eyebrows, who are looking for structure or thickness, because it allows to fix their shape and give them a beautiful curve that lasts between 6 and 8 weeks .

4. The end of the fashion for thick eyebrows?
While thick, full eyebrows have dominated the trends in recent years, thinner brows are gradually making a comeback. This shift is particularly visible on the catwalks and in fashion magazines.
-
Thick eyebrows are still ideal for wider faces or those with strong features, as they balance the proportions.
-
Thinner eyebrows are making a comeback and are best suited to delicate faces and fine features, adding a touch of elegance and femininity.
